Chotila Temple – A Spiritual Gem on the Way to Junagadh
Chotila Temple is a symbol of devotion that will never go out of style. Every step up the hill is a journey of faith and spiritual awakening.
Chotila Temple – A Spiritual Gem on the Way to Junagadh Read More »